WebTingling and numbness can also occur due to breast cancer surgery, according to the American Cancer Society 1. **These sensations may even increase a few weeks after the procedure. The tingling may also extend to the chest wall or toward the armpit. Nerves heal slowly so it may take weeks or months for these symptoms to go away. magali courmontagne

WebBrachial neuritis is a form of peripheral neuropathy that affects the chest, shoulder, arm and hand. Peripheral neuropathy is a disease characterized by pain or loss of function in the nerves that carry signals to and from the brain and spinal cord (the central nervous system) to other parts of the body. It is a fairly rare condition.
